Advertisement

MySQL基础知识与实例教程教案.doc

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教案详细介绍了MySQL数据库的基础知识及其实用操作技巧,并通过具体实例帮助读者掌握SQL语句的应用。适合初学者快速入门和进阶学习使用。 免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免費分享

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MySQL.doc
    优质
    本教案详细介绍了MySQL数据库的基础知识及其实用操作技巧,并通过具体实例帮助读者掌握SQL语句的应用。适合初学者快速入门和进阶学习使用。 免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免费分享免費分享
  • MySQL练习题参考答.doc
    优质
    这份文档为学习MySQL数据库的新手提供了全面的基础知识讲解、实用示例以及配套的练习题和详细解答,是掌握MySQL技能的理想资源。 MySQL是一种广泛使用的开源关系型数据库管理系统,它具有开源、免费以及体积小且易于安装的特点,并且功能强大。相比商业化的数据库系统如SQL Server、DB2、Informix、Sybase 和 Oracle,MySQL 提供了更加经济的解决方案,特别适合中小型企业或个人开发者使用。 在数据库管理中,数学模型用于描述数据结构和关系的基础框架。常见的数学模型包括层次型、网状型以及面向对象的关系型等几种类型。其中,关系模型是目前最普遍采用的一种模式,并且SQL(Structured Query Language)语言专门用于管理和操作这种类型的数据库系统。 尽管 SQL 是一种专为管理与操作关系数据库设计的查询语言,但它并不是一个完整的程序设计工具,不具备创建图形用户界面的能力。开发人员通常会结合 Java、C++、PHP 等面向对象编程语言来构建 GUI,并利用SQL进行数据处理和交互任务。值得注意的是,不同的数据库管理系统可能有自己的 SQL 特性或扩展。 从外观上看,数据库表与电子表格(如 Excel)相似,但它们之间存在本质的区别:在数据库中每个字段名称必须唯一、每一列都有预定义的数据类型且每条记录也需是唯一的;此外,数据库还支持更为复杂的查询和约束条件设置,比如主键、外键等规则的实施。相比之下,电子表格不具备这些功能。 有许多工具和技术可以辅助进行数据库设计工作,例如数据模型(包括ER模型及类图)、专业的数据建模软件(如 ERwin 或 PowerDesigner)以及关系型数据库的设计原则与方法论。通过使用这些资源和技巧,设计师能够更加有效地理解并构建出完整且一致的数据库结构。 在“选课系统”中,利用数据库技术可以解决多种实际问题:例如存储管理课程、学生、教师及班级信息;防止课程名重复出现;控制每位讲师申报课程的数量上限;设定每门课程的最大选修人数限制等。此外还可以实现如选课与退课等功能,并且能够对每个学生的最大可选择科目数量进行监管,同时还能记录并动态更新剩余名额情况统计满员的课程信息以及查询教师所申请的所有课程列表等等功能。通过合理的数据库设计和运用 SQL 查询语句,则可以高效地完成上述所有任务。
  • Java
    优质
    《Java基础知识案例教程》是一本全面介绍Java编程语言基础概念与应用实践的学习指南,通过丰富的实例帮助读者快速掌握开发技能。 Java基础的案例分析与实例教学适合新手学习及回顾查阅,有助于夯实基础知识。
  • Maya
    优质
    《Maya基础知识与实例教程》是一本系统介绍三维动画软件Maya使用技巧的专业书籍,通过丰富的实例帮助读者掌握建模、渲染及动画制作等核心技能。 本书以基础知识与实例相结合的方式,逐步深入地介绍了Maya的基本功能、工具及特效的应用方法。书中涵盖了NURBS曲线建模、Polygon建模、细分表面建模、材质设置、灯光应用以及渲染技术等内容,并详细讲解了角色动画和特效的制作技巧。读者通过学习本书的内容,不仅能掌握Maya的各种工具与使用技巧,还能了解其在产品设计流程中的具体应用情况。同时,在实际操作中学习各种技术和方法,有助于提升个人的应用灵活性及创新能力。 全书共分为十二章: - 第一章为快速入门指南,简述了Maya的发展历程及其广泛应用领域,并介绍了基本功能和界面构成。 - 第二章介绍编辑物体的基本知识与工具使用技巧,通过实例激发读者的学习兴趣并掌握基础制作流程。 - 接下来的几章节(第三至第六)分别深入讲解NURBS曲线建模、曲面建模及Polygon建模的具体方法,并结合实际案例让读者了解如何在不同情形下选择合适的命令和工具进行模型的创建与编辑。 - 第七章到第九章则转向材质贴图技术、灯光特效设置以及渲染输出参数调整等方面的知识点,帮助用户掌握这些关键技能。 - 动画制作相关知识从第十章开始介绍,涵盖基本动画原理至复杂角色动作设计等多方面内容,并通过实例演示来加深理解。 - 最后两章节(第十一和十二)则侧重于粒子特效与动力学应用以及综合项目的实践操作,旨在锻炼读者的实际问题解决能力和创新思维。
  • PHP-PPT.rar
    优质
    本资源为《PHP基础知识案例教程》PPT形式的教学资料,涵盖PHP编程语言的基础概念、语法结构及实战案例,适合初学者学习使用。 《PHP基础案例教程》是2020年1月由人民邮电出版社出版的一本书籍。全书共包含16章内容,其中有12个章节用于讲解新知识,另外4个章节则通过阶段性的项目案例来巩固所学的内容。在每个知识点的讲解部分都配有动手实践环节,帮助读者即时练习和掌握刚刚学到的知识点。 当完成一个学习阶段之后,书中会提供一些综合性较强的项目开发任务供读者挑战,例如“许愿墙”、“在线相册”以及“趣PHP网站”等案例,这些项目的目的是让读者能够将所学知识应用到实际的开发场景中,并积累宝贵的实战经验。
  • Java.rar
    优质
    《Java基础知识案例教程》是一本全面介绍Java编程语言基础概念与实践技巧的学习资料,通过丰富的实例帮助读者快速掌握Java开发技能。适合初学者入门使用。 Java基础案例教程(黑马程序员版)
  • Java.rar
    优质
    《Java基础知识案例教程》是一本针对初学者设计的学习资料,通过丰富的实例讲解了Java编程语言的核心概念和基本语法。适合自学或教学使用。 Java是一种广泛使用的面向对象的编程语言,以其跨平台、高性能和丰富的类库而著名。本教程将通过一系列基础案例,帮助初学者理解并掌握Java的核心概念。 1. **环境配置**:在开始学习Java之前,你需要在计算机上安装Java Development Kit (JDK) 并配置好环境变量,包括`JAVA_HOME`, `PATH` 和 `CLASSPATH`. 这确保了系统能够找到Java编译器(javac)和Java运行时环境(Java Virtual Machine, JVM)。 2. **Hello, World!**:第一个Java程序通常是从打印Hello, World!开始的。这涉及到类的定义,主方法(`main` 方法),以及 `System.out.println()` 语句,它是输出到控制台的基本方式。 3. **数据类型**:Java有两类数据类型:基本类型(如int、char、boolean等)和引用类型(如类、接口和数组)。理解它们的区别对于编写有效的代码至关重要。 4. **变量与常量**:变量是存储数据的地方,而常量一旦定义就不能改变。了解如何声明、初始化和使用它们是基础。 5. **运算符与表达式**:Java支持各种运算符,包括算术、比较和逻辑运算符。理解它们的优先级和用法可以写出更复杂的表达式。 6. **控制流**:包括条件语句(if-else)、循环(for、while、do-while)和跳转语句(break、continue)。这些结构控制程序的执行流程。 7. **数组**:数组是存储相同类型元素的集合。理解如何声明、初始化、遍历和操作数组对于处理数据集很有用。 8. **方法**:方法是代码的重用单元。通过定义方法,你可以封装特定功能,然后在需要的时候调用。 9. **类与对象**:Java是面向对象的,这意味着程序由类和对象组成。类定义了对象的结构和行为,而对象是类的实例。 10. **封装、继承和多态**:这是面向对象编程的三大特性。封装保护数据不被外部随意访问;继承使得子类可以从父类继承属性和方法;多态则允许你使用一个接口来调用不同类的方法。 11. **异常处理**:Java提供了一套强大的异常处理机制,帮助程序处理运行时错误。通过try-catch-finally块,你可以优雅地捕获并处理异常,保证程序的健壮性。 12. **输入输出(IO)**:Java提供了丰富的IO流API,用于读写文件、网络通信等。理解InputStream、OutputStream、Reader和Writer类的作用是处理数据交换的关键。 13. **集合框架**:ArrayList、LinkedList、HashMap等都是Java集合框架的一部分,它们提供了高效的数据存储和操作方法。 14. **多线程**:Java内置对多线程的支持,理解如何创建和管理线程,以及同步和互斥的概念,对于构建高效的并发应用程序至关重要。 15. **接口与抽象类**:接口定义了行为规范,而抽象类可以包含未实现的方法。它们都是实现多态的有效工具。 通过阅读相关教程文件(如“java基础案例教程.md”),你将能深入理解这些概念,并通过实践案例来巩固知识。这个教程以易懂的方式讲解,适合初学者入门。不断练习和尝试,你将逐渐掌握Java编程的精髓。
  • Word 2003.doc
    优质
    《Word 2003基础知识教程》是一份全面介绍Microsoft Word 2003基本操作和功能使用的文档,适合初学者学习。 Microsoft Word 2003 是一款广受欢迎的文字处理工具,它是 Microsoft Office 套件的一部分,主要用于创建、编辑和格式化文档文本,并适用于制作报告、信函、备忘录等各种类型的文件。Word 2003 提供了丰富的功能特性,如模板、主控文档管理、修订历史记录以及版本控制等,非常适合个人用户或团队协作使用。 在学习 Word 2003 的基础教程时,首先要掌握的是如何启动和退出该程序的方法。可以通过【开始】菜单选择【程序】选项,在【Microsoft Office】目录中找到并点击【Microsoft Office 边用边学 word2003】来打开软件。另外也可以创建桌面快捷方式以方便快速启动 Word 2003,只需双击相应的图标即可。退出程序则可以通过菜单栏的【文件】【退出】命令实现。 Word 2003 的工作界面主要包括以下部分: 1. 标题栏:显示当前文档名和软件名称,并提供最小化、最大化及关闭按钮。 2. 菜单栏:包含如【文件】、【编辑】等常用操作选项。 3. 工具栏:默认包括【常用】和【格式】工具栏,用户可根据需要选择其他工具栏的显示或隐藏。例如可以使用视图菜单中的【工具栏】命令来调整设置。 4. 标尺:水平与垂直标尺帮助进行文本对齐及段落设定。 5. 文档编辑区:这是主要的操作区域,在这里输入和修改文档内容。 6. 滚动条:允许用户在文档中上下左右移动浏览所需信息。 7. 任务窗格:提供快捷命令,便于用户的操作使用。 8. 状态栏:显示当前文档的状态信息,比如页码、章节数及光标位置等。 学习 Word 2003 的基础步骤之一是创建新文档。启动程序时,默认会生成一个名为“文档1”的空白文件。如需创建更多新的文档,则可以点击工具栏上的【新建空白文档】按钮或通过菜单中的【文件】【新建】命令来完成,之后在弹出的任务窗格中选择【空白文档】即可。 此外,在学习过程中还需要掌握如何输入及编辑文本内容,并学会保存已编辑的文档。通常可以通过菜单栏中的【文件】【保存】选项或是使用快捷键Ctrl+S来进行文件保存操作。对于初学者来说,了解并熟练运用这些基础操作至关重要,因为它们构成了日常使用 Word 进行文档处理的基础。 在后续的学习阶段中可能会进一步探讨更多高级功能的应用技巧,例如文本格式化(字体、大小、颜色及对齐方式等)、段落设置(缩进、间距和行距等)、页眉与页脚的添加以及插入图片或表格等内容。通过逐步深入学习和实践操作,用户可以不断提高自己的 Word 2003 使用技能,并满足日常工作和个人项目的需求。
  • Maya入门
    优质
    本教程为初学者提供全面易懂的Maya软件基础操作指南,涵盖建模、动画及渲染技巧,帮助快速掌握三维设计核心技能。 Maya入门基础教程教案适用于学校老师上课使用,内容详尽,并包含相关截图以辅助理解。
  • Java(第二版)_PPT.zip
    优质
    《Java基础知识案例教程(第二版)》提供了全面且详细的Java编程入门指导与实践案例。该资源包含课程讲义及示例代码,以帮助读者深入理解Java语言的核心概念和应用技巧。 Java基础案例教程(第2版)PPT.zip